  55. static int af9015_rw_udev(struct usb_device *udev, struct req_t *req)
  56. {
  57. #define BUF_LEN 63
  58. #define REQ_HDR_LEN 8 /* send header size */
  59. #define ACK_HDR_LEN 2 /* rece header size */
  60. int act_len, ret;
  61. u8 buf[BUF_LEN];
  62. u8 write = 1;
  63. u8 msg_len = REQ_HDR_LEN;
  64. static u8 seq; /* packet sequence number */
  65. if (mutex_lock_interruptible(&af9015_usb_mutex) < 0)
  66. return -EAGAIN;
  67. buf[0] = req->cmd;
  68. buf[1] = seq++;
  69. buf[2] = req->i2c_addr;
  70. buf[3] = req->addr >> 8;
  71. buf[4] = req->addr & 0xff;
  72. buf[5] = req->mbox;
  73. buf[6] = req->addr_len;
  74. buf[7] = req->data_len;
  75. switch (req->cmd) {
  76. case GET_CONFIG:
  77. case READ_MEMORY:
  78. case RECONNECT_USB:
  79. case GET_IR_CODE:
  80. write = 0;
  81. break;
  82. case READ_I2C:
  83. write = 0;
  84. buf[2] |= 0x01; /* set I2C direction */
  85. case WRITE_I2C:
  86. buf[0] = READ_WRITE_I2C;
  87. break;
  88. case WRITE_MEMORY:
  89. if (((req->addr & 0xff00) == 0xff00) ||
  90. ((req->addr & 0xff00) == 0xae00))
  91. buf[0] = WRITE_VIRTUAL_MEMORY;
  92. case WRITE_VIRTUAL_MEMORY:
  93. case COPY_FIRMWARE:
  94. case DOWNLOAD_FIRMWARE:
  95. case BOOT:
  96. break;
  97. default:
  98. err("unknown command:%d", req->cmd);
  99. ret = -1;
  100. goto error_unlock;
  101. }
  102. /* buffer overflow check */
  103. if ((write && (req->data_len > BUF_LEN - REQ_HDR_LEN)) ||
  104. (!write && (req->data_len > BUF_LEN - ACK_HDR_LEN))) {
  105. err("too much data; cmd:%d len:%d", req->cmd, req->data_len);
  106. ret = -EINVAL;
  107. goto error_unlock;
  108. }
  109. /* write requested */
  110. if (write) {
  111. memcpy(&buf[REQ_HDR_LEN], req->data, req->data_len);
  112. msg_len += req->data_len;
  113. }
  114. deb_xfer(">>> ");
  115. debug_dump(buf, msg_len, deb_xfer);
  116. /* send req */
  117. ret = usb_bulk_msg(udev, usb_sndbulkpipe(udev, 0x02), buf, msg_len,
  118. &act_len, AF9015_USB_TIMEOUT);
  119. if (ret)
  120. err("bulk message failed:%d (%d/%d)", ret, msg_len, act_len);
  121. else
  122. if (act_len != msg_len)
  123. ret = -1; /* all data is not send */
  124. if (ret)
  125. goto error_unlock;
  126. /* no ack for those packets */
  127. if (req->cmd == DOWNLOAD_FIRMWARE || req->cmd == RECONNECT_USB)
  128. goto exit_unlock;
  129. /* write receives seq + status = 2 bytes
  130. read receives seq + status + data = 2 + N bytes */
  131. msg_len = ACK_HDR_LEN;
  132. if (!write)
  133. msg_len += req->data_len;
  134. ret = usb_bulk_msg(udev, usb_rcvbulkpipe(udev, 0x81), buf, msg_len,
  135. &act_len, AF9015_USB_TIMEOUT);
  136. if (ret) {
  137. err("recv bulk message failed:%d", ret);
  138. ret = -1;
  139. goto error_unlock;
  140. }
  141. deb_xfer("<<< ");
  142. debug_dump(buf, act_len, deb_xfer);
  143. /* remote controller query status is 1 if remote code is not received */
  144. if (req->cmd == GET_IR_CODE && buf[1] == 1) {
  145. buf[1] = 0; /* clear command "error" status */
  146. memset(&buf[2], 0, req->data_len);
  147. buf[3] = 1; /* no remote code received mark */
  148. }
  149. /* check status */
  150. if (buf[1]) {
  151. err("command failed:%d", buf[1]);
  152. ret = -1;
  153. goto error_unlock;
  154. }
  155. /* read request, copy returned data to return buf */
  156. if (!write)
  157. memcpy(req->data, &buf[ACK_HDR_LEN], req->data_len);
  158. error_unlock:
  159. exit_unlock:
  160. mutex_unlock(&af9015_usb_mutex);
  161. return ret;
  162. }

  201. static int af9015_i2c_xfer(struct i2c_adapter *adap, struct i2c_msg msg[],
  202. int num)
  203. {
  204. struct dvb_usb_device *d = i2c_get_adapdata(adap);
  205. int ret = 0, i = 0;
  206. u16 addr;
  207. u8 mbox, addr_len;
  208. struct req_t req;
  209. /* TODO: implement bus lock
  210. The bus lock is needed because there is two tuners both using same I2C-address.
  211. Due to that the only way to select correct tuner is use demodulator I2C-gate.
  212. ................................................
  213. . AF9015 includes integrated AF9013 demodulator.
  214. . ____________ ____________ . ____________
  215. .| uC | | demod | . | tuner |
  216. .|------------| |------------| . |------------|
  217. .| AF9015 | | AF9013/5 | . | MXL5003 |
  218. .| |--+----I2C-------|-----/ -----|-.-----I2C-------| |
  219. .| | | | addr 0x38 | . | addr 0xc6 |
  220. .|____________| | |____________| . |____________|
  221. .................|..............................
  222. | ____________ ____________
  223. | | demod | | tuner |
  224. | |------------| |------------|
  225. | | AF9013 | | MXL5003 |
  226. +----I2C-------|-----/ -----|-------I2C-------| |
  227. | addr 0x3a | | addr 0xc6 |
  228. |____________| |____________|
  229. */
  230. if (mutex_lock_interruptible(&d->i2c_mutex) < 0)
  231. return -EAGAIN;
  232. while (i < num) {
  233. if (msg[i].addr == af9015_af9013_config[0].demod_address ||
  234. msg[i].addr == af9015_af9013_config[1].demod_address) {
  235. addr = msg[i].buf[0] << 8;
  236. addr += msg[i].buf[1];
  237. mbox = msg[i].buf[2];
  238. addr_len = 3;
  239. } else {
  240. addr = msg[i].buf[0];
  241. addr_len = 1;
  242. mbox = 0;
  243. }
  244. if (num > i + 1 && (msg[i+1].flags & I2C_M_RD)) {
  245. if (msg[i].addr ==
  246. af9015_af9013_config[0].demod_address)
  247. req.cmd = READ_MEMORY;
  248. else
  249. req.cmd = READ_I2C;
  250. req.i2c_addr = msg[i].addr;
  251. req.addr = addr;
  252. req.mbox = mbox;
  253. req.addr_len = addr_len;
  254. req.data_len = msg[i+1].len;
  255. req.data = &msg[i+1].buf[0];
  256. ret = af9015_ctrl_msg(d, &req);
  257. i += 2;
  258. } else if (msg[i].flags & I2C_M_RD) {
  259. ret = -EINVAL;
  260. if (msg[i].addr ==
  261. af9015_af9013_config[0].demod_address)
  262. goto error;
  263. else
  264. req.cmd = READ_I2C;
  265. req.i2c_addr = msg[i].addr;
  266. req.addr = addr;
  267. req.mbox = mbox;
  268. req.addr_len = addr_len;
  269. req.data_len = msg[i].len;
  270. req.data = &msg[i].buf[0];
  271. ret = af9015_ctrl_msg(d, &req);
  272. i += 1;
  273. } else {
  274. if (msg[i].addr ==
  275. af9015_af9013_config[0].demod_address)
  276. req.cmd = WRITE_MEMORY;
  277. else
  278. req.cmd = WRITE_I2C;
  279. req.i2c_addr = msg[i].addr;
  280. req.addr = addr;
  281. req.mbox = mbox;
  282. req.addr_len = addr_len;
  283. req.data_len = msg[i].len-addr_len;
  284. req.data = &msg[i].buf[addr_len];
  285. ret = af9015_ctrl_msg(d, &req);
  286. i += 1;
  287. }
  288. if (ret)
  289. goto error;
  290. }
  291. ret = i;
  292. error:
  293. mutex_unlock(&d->i2c_mutex);
  294. return ret;
  295. }

  330. static int af9015_init_endpoint(struct dvb_usb_device *d)
  331. {
  332. int ret;
  333. u16 frame_size;
  334. u8 packet_size;
  335. deb_info("%s: USB speed:%d\n", __func__, d->udev->speed);
  336. /* Windows driver uses packet count 21 for USB1.1 and 348 for USB2.0.
  337. We use smaller - about 1/4 from the original, 5 and 87. */
  338. #define TS_PACKET_SIZE 188
  339. #define TS_USB20_PACKET_COUNT 87
  340. #define TS_USB20_FRAME_SIZE (TS_PACKET_SIZE*TS_USB20_PACKET_COUNT)
  341. #define TS_USB11_PACKET_COUNT 5
  342. #define TS_USB11_FRAME_SIZE (TS_PACKET_SIZE*TS_USB11_PACKET_COUNT)
  343. #define TS_USB20_MAX_PACKET_SIZE 512
  344. #define TS_USB11_MAX_PACKET_SIZE 64
  345. if (d->udev->speed == USB_SPEED_FULL) {
  346. frame_size = TS_USB11_FRAME_SIZE/4;
  347. packet_size = TS_USB11_MAX_PACKET_SIZE/4;
  348. } else {
  349. frame_size = TS_USB20_FRAME_SIZE/4;
  350. packet_size = TS_USB20_MAX_PACKET_SIZE/4;
  351. }
  352. ret = af9015_set_reg_bit(d, 0xd507, 2); /* assert EP4 reset */
  353. if (ret)
  354. goto error;
  355. ret = af9015_set_reg_bit(d, 0xd50b, 1); /* assert EP5 reset */
  356. if (ret)
  357. goto error;
  358.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xdd11, 5); /* disable EP4 */
  359. if (ret)
  360. goto error;
  361.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xdd11, 6); /* disable EP5 */
  362. if (ret)
  363. goto error;
  364. ret = af9015_set_reg_bit(d, 0xdd11, 5); /* enable EP4 */
  365. if (ret)
  366. goto error;
  367. if (af9015_config.dual_mode) {
  368. ret = af9015_set_reg_bit(d, 0xdd11, 6); /* enable EP5 */
  369. if (ret)
  370. goto error;
  371. }
  372.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xdd13, 5); /* disable EP4 NAK */
  373. if (ret)
  374. goto error;
  375. if (af9015_config.dual_mode) {
  376.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xdd13, 6); /* disable EP5 NAK */
  377. if (ret)
  378. goto error;
  379. }
  380. /* EP4 xfer length */
  381.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xdd88, frame_size & 0xff);
  382. if (ret)
  383. goto error;
  384.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xdd89, frame_size >> 8);
  385. if (ret)
  386. goto error;
  387. /* EP5 xfer length */
  388.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xdd8a, frame_size & 0xff);
  389. if (ret)
  390. goto error;
  391.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xdd8b, frame_size >> 8);
  392. if (ret)
  393. goto error;
  394.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xdd0c, packet_size); /* EP4 packet size */
  395. if (ret)
  396. goto error;
  397.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xdd0d, packet_size); /* EP5 packet size */
  398. if (ret)
  399. goto error;
  400.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xd507, 2); /* negate EP4 reset */
  401. if (ret)
  402. goto error;
  403. if (af9015_config.dual_mode) {
  404.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xd50b, 1); /* negate EP5 reset */
  405. if (ret)
  406. goto error;
  407. }
  408. /* enable / disable mp2if2 */
  409. if (af9015_config.dual_mode)
  410. ret = af9015_set_reg_bit(d, 0xd50b, 0);
  411. else
  412. ret = af9015_clear_reg_bit(d, 0xd50b, 0);
  413. error:
  414. if (ret)
  415. err("endpoint init failed:%d", ret);
  416. return ret;
  417. }
  418. static int af9015_copy_firmware(struct dvb_usb_device *d)
  419. {
  420. int ret;
  421. u8 fw_params[4];
  422. u8 val, i;
  423. struct req_t req = {COPY_FIRMWARE, 0, 0x5100, 0, 0, sizeof(fw_params),
  424. fw_params };
  425. deb_info("%s:\n", __func__);
  426. fw_params[0] = af9015_config.firmware_size >> 8;
  427. fw_params[1] = af9015_config.firmware_size & 0xff;
  428. fw_params[2] = af9015_config.firmware_checksum >> 8;
  429. fw_params[3] = af9015_config.firmware_checksum & 0xff;
  430. /* wait 2nd demodulator ready */
  431. msleep(100);
  432. ret = af9015_read_reg_i2c(d, 0x3a, 0x98be, &val);
  433. if (ret)
  434. goto error;
  435. else
  436. deb_info("%s: firmware status:%02x\n", __func__, val);
  437. if (val == 0x0c) /* fw is running, no need for download */
  438. goto exit;
  439. /* set I2C master clock to fast (to speed up firmware copy) */
  440.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xd416, 0x04); /* 0x04 * 400ns */
  441. if (ret)
  442. goto error;
  443. msleep(50);
  444. /* copy firmware */
  445. ret = af9015_ctrl_msg(d, &req);
  446. if (ret)
  447. err("firmware copy cmd failed:%d", ret);
  448. deb_info("%s: firmware copy done\n", __func__);
  449. /* set I2C master clock back to normal */
  450. ret = af9015_write_reg(d, 0xd416, 0x14); /* 0x14 * 400ns */
  451. if (ret)
  452. goto error;
  453. /* request boot firmware */
  454. ret = af9015_write_reg_i2c(d, af9015_af9013_config[1].demod_address,
  455. 0xe205, 1);
  456. deb_info("%s: firmware boot cmd status:%d\n", __func__, ret);
  457. if (ret)
  458. goto error;
  459. for (i = 0; i < 15; i++) {
  460. msleep(100);
  461. /* check firmware status */
  462. ret = af9015_read_reg_i2c(d,
  463. af9015_af9013_config[1].demod_address, 0x98be, &val);
  464. deb_info("%s: firmware status cmd status:%d fw status:%02x\n",
  465. __func__, ret, val);
  466. if (ret)
  467. goto error;
  468. if (val == 0x0c || val == 0x04) /* success or fail */
  469. break;
  470. }
  471. if (val == 0x04) {
  472. err("firmware did not run");
  473. ret = -1;
  474. } else if (val != 0x0c) {
  475. err("firmware boot timeout");
  476. ret = -1;
  477. }
  478. error:
  479. exit:
  480. return ret;
  481. }
